The growth hormone releasing peptide, in plain words
Many adults experience a gradual decline in key hormone levels as they age. This often leads to symptoms like chronic fatigue, diminished physical recovery, and difficulty maintaining a healthy weight. Understanding your body’s endocrine system offers solutions for these common challenges.
One innovative approach involves stimulating your body’s own hormone production. This growth hormone releasing peptide acts as a powerful signal. It tells your pituitary gland, a small but vital organ at the base of your brain, to release more of your natural growth hormone in a pulsatile manner. This process is very similar to how your body released growth hormone when you were younger.
The increased, natural release of growth hormone then stimulates the liver to produce insulin-like growth factor 1, or IGF-1. This entire cascade is a physiological process, meaning it works with your body, not by directly introducing synthetic hormones. The therapy aims to restore more youthful hormone rhythms, supporting a wide range of biological functions.

It is important to understand that the Sermorelin Peptide you might receive is a compounded medication. It is typically prepared by a specialized pharmacy under sections 503A or 503B of the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act. This means it is not an FDA-approved drug in the traditional sense, but it is lawfully dispensed by pharmacies meeting stringent quality standards. What the timeline looks like
Starting the protocol typically involves a few key steps. First, complete the online intake and lab orders. This usually takes just a few days. Then, you undergo the necessary blood work at a local lab. Your consultation with the Massachusetts-licensed clinician follows quickly after lab results are available.
Once your prescription for this growth hormone releasing peptide is approved, the compounding pharmacy prepares it. Shipping often takes a few business days. You will receive your medication ready for subcutaneous administration, usually a small injection before bedtime. The nightly timing aligns with your body’s natural pulsatile hormone release.
You should understand that results are not immediate. This therapy works by gradually stimulating your body’s own systems. Many patients report initial improvements in sleep quality within a few weeks. More significant changes in energy, body composition, and recovery often become noticeable after two to three months of consistent use. You will typically have follow-up consultations and lab re-checks to monitor your progress, ensuring the protocol remains optimal for you. Adjustments to dosage may occur based on your response and new lab data, including your IGF-1 levels and fasting glucose.

Safety is a primary concern with any medical protocol. This therapy is generally well-tolerated. Potential side effects are usually mild and temporary. These can include injection site reactions like redness or irritation, headaches, or mild nausea. Serious adverse events are rare. Your prescribing clinician will discuss all potential risks and benefits during your consultation, ensuring you make an informed decision.
